The limit of detection (LOD) is the smallest amount of analyte that can be distinguished from the background noise. The LOD value corresponds to the concentration at which the analyte signal is three times larger than the standard deviation of the blank signal. Below this value, the analyte signal cannot be differentiated from the background noise. It is calculated by dividing the calibration slope by 3 times the standard deviation of the blank signals.

Albert Bandura's observational learning, also known as imitation or modeling, occurs when a person observes and imitates another's behavior. It is a quicker process than operant conditioning. A well-known example is the Bobo doll study, where children who saw an adult acting aggressively towards the doll were more likely to act aggressively when left alone, compared to those who observed a nonaggressive adult. EDTA titrations may necessitate masking and demasking agents to temporarily protect a particular metal ion in a mixture from the EDTA reaction. These agents facilitate the sequential analysis of the metal ions by forming stable complexes with some—but not all—metal ions during certain steps.

背景情况:

  • 域自适应对象检测 (DAOD) 在未标记的目标数据上使用标记的源数据训练模型.
  • 平均教师的自我训练对DAOD有效,但受到杂的伪标签的阻碍.
  • 主动域调整 (ADA) 选择性地注释信息数据以降低成本,但其在DAOD中的使用是有限的.

研究的目的:

  • 开发一个有效的主动学习框架,用于域自适应对象检测.
  • 解决DAOD的教师自我培训中杂的伪标签的挑战.
  • 通过选择最有价值的目标样本来最大限度地降低DAOD中的注释成本.

主要方法:

  • 建议为积极的DAOD提供前沿意识的积极自我训练 (FAST) 框架.
  • 引入了前景多样性集群采样 (FDCS) 以最大限度地提高前景对象多样性.
  • 实施教师-学生差异不确定性抽样 (TDUN) 来识别不确定的预测.
  • 利用了与专用抽样模型脱的积极学习范式.

主要成果:

  • FAST显著提高了目标域上的对象检测性能.
  • 拟议的抽样策略有效地识别了有信息性的目标样本.
  • 实验结果表明,在多个DAOD数据集中,性能优越.
  • 该方法在具有挑战性的场景中成功地弥合了领域差距.

结论:

  • FAST建立了一个有效的框架,用于主动域自适应对象检测.
  • 结合FDCS和TDUN采样策略,优化了注释工作.
  • 拟议的方法提供了一个有前途的解决方案,以最小的注释成本来改进DAOD.
